The Centre in Green Chemistry and Catalysis (CGCC) is pleased to present the fourth edition of its Summer School in Green Chemistry, which will take place from June 16 to 18, 2026, at Le Baluchon Eco-Resort.
This year, the event is expanding to a three-day format, offering students an even richer experience focused on learning, scientific exchange, and networking.
The program will bring together members of the CGCC community for a variety of academic and social activities. Participants will have the opportunity to attend invited lectures, present their research projects, and engage with fellow students and researchers in an environment that fosters collaboration and professional development.
In addition to the scientific program, several outdoor and networking activities are planned to strengthen connections among members of the Centre. This year, the CGCC Equity, Diversity and Inclusion (EDI) Committee will also contribute to the program by organizing interactive activities designed to promote group cohesion and inclusivity.
Since its inception, the CGCC Summer School has become a flagship event for students in green chemistry, providing a stimulating environment where scientific excellence, knowledge sharing, and community spirit come together.
